What to Focus On

  • Psychology comes from psyche and logos.
  • Aristotle defined psychology as the science of soul.
  • Descartes defined psychology as the science of consciousness.

  • Psychology uses scientific methods.
  • It is a positive science, not a normative science.
  • It is a developing positive science, not a perfect pure science.

  • Pre-scientific psychology relied on supernatural explanations.
  • Greek philosophers began the study of mind and soul.
  • Dualism separated mind and body.
